About The Position

Our client is building applied AI technology for the architecture, engineering, and construction ecosystem. Their mission is to transform how the built environment is designed and constructed by giving civil, structural, and MEP engineering teams modern AI tools to solve complex infrastructure, energy, and climate challenges. This role sits at the intersection of engineering, product, customer deployment, and applied AI. The engineer will work directly with civil, structural, and MEP engineering firms to understand their operations, identify high-leverage workflows, and build tools that create immediate value. This is not a traditional ticket-based engineering role. The engineer will embed with customers, earn trust with technical users, ship fast, debug in production, and bring learnings back into the core product. The ideal candidate is highly technical, customer-facing, curious, low-ego, and willing to do whatever it takes to make deployments successful.
